Energy transfer from InGaN quantum wells to Au nanoclusters via optical waveguiding
1Department of Physics and Center for Nanotechnology at CYCU, Chung Yuan Christian University, 32023 Chung-Li, Taiwan.
Optics Express
|March 30, 2011
Abstract:
We present the first observation of resonance energy transfer from InGaN quantum wells to Au nanoclusters via optical waveguiding. Steady-state and time-resolved photoluminescence measurements provide conclusive evidence of resonance energy transfer and obtain an optimum transfer efficiency of ~72%. A set of rate equations is successfully used to model the kinetics of resonance energy transfer.
